Course Content

• Introduction to Robotics and Automation
• Robotics System Architecture and Design
• Programming and Control of Robotic Systems (including Robot Operating System - ROS)
• Sensor Integration and Data Acquisition for Robotics
• Robotic Vision and Image Processing
• Advanced Robotics Integration Techniques
• Industrial Robot Safety and Risk Assessment
• Case Studies in Robotics Integration and Deployment

Career Role (Robotics Integration) Description
Robotics Integration Engineer Design, implement, and maintain robotic systems in manufacturing or other industries. High demand for automation expertise.
Robotics Software Developer Develop and maintain software for robotic systems, focusing on control algorithms and AI integration. Strong programming skills are essential (Python, C++).
AI-powered Robotics Specialist Specializes in integrating AI capabilities into robotics systems, allowing robots to learn and adapt in dynamic environments.
Robotics Technician Maintain and repair robotic systems, ensuring efficient operation and minimizing downtime. Requires hands-on technical skills.
